在HTML中,设置图像的替换文本是一种重要的辅助功能,它可以帮助那些使用屏幕阅读器的用户理解图像的内容,替换文本通常被称为“alt”属性,它为图像提供了一个简短的描述,这种描述不仅有助于提高网站的可访问性,还能在图像因为某些原因无法加载时,提供给用户一个替代的信息,本文将详细介绍如何为HTML图像设置替换文本,并提供一些常见问题的解答。
要为图像设置替换文本,您需要在HTML代码中使用<img>
标签,并为其添加alt
属性。alt
属性的值应该是对图像内容的简短描述。
<img src="example.jpg" alt="一只可爱的小猫">
在这个例子中,我们为名为"example.jpg"的图像设置了一个描述性的文字“一只可爱的小猫”,这样,当用户访问网站时,如果图像无法加载或者用户使用屏幕阅读器,他们就能看到这个描述性的文本。
在设置替换文本时,需要注意以下几点:
1、尽量使用简洁明了的语言描述图像内容,以便用户快速理解。
2、如果图像是纯装饰性的,没有实际意义,可以使用空的alt
属性,如<img src="example.jpg" alt="">
,这将告诉屏幕阅读器忽略这个图像。
3、避免使用“图像”或“图片”等模糊的词汇作为alt
文本,除非这是对图像内容的准确描述。
4、对于包含文本的图像,应将图像中的文本内容作为alt
属性的值。
现在我们已经了解了如何为HTML图像设置替换文本,接下来我们来看看一些常见问题及其解答。
Q1: 为什么要为图像设置替换文本?
A1: 设置替换文本有助于提高网站的可访问性,让使用屏幕阅读器的用户能够理解图像内容,当图像无法加载时,替换文本可以作为一个替代信息展示给用户。
Q2: 如何为图像设置多个描述性文本?
A2: 对于需要更详细描述的图像,可以使用longdesc
属性或者在一个<img>
标签内部使用<figcaption>
标签,不过,目前longdesc
属性的支持有限,更推荐使用<figcaption>
标签。
Q3: 替换文本对搜索引擎优化(SEO)有什么影响?
A3: 替换文本有助于搜索引擎更好地理解图像内容,从而提高网站的搜索引擎排名,使用描述性的alt
文本还可以提高网站的用户体验,使其更加友好。